Bruce Komiske is considered a "world expert" on all facets of creating "Children's Hospitals and Hospital Planning, Design and Construction". He is an experienced healthcare executive who has had the opportunity to plan, build, operate and raise the philanthropic support for eight new hospitals, each more innovative than the previous, all from the owner's perspective. In addition, he is a frequent speaker, author and consultant for hospitals around the world including, Middle East, England, Europe, and the Orient, on the inclusive planning process, healing environments, children's hospitals - design and construction, healthcare design, project management and healthcare philanthropy.

He is also the editor and creator of the Amazon's rated "5 star" Children's Hospitals - the World's Best Designed. (Images Publishing), Children's Hospitals - The Future of Healing Environments, (Images Publishing), Maria's Wish, the Story of the Maria Fareri Children's Hospital (Images Publishing) and Family Partnership in Hospital Care (Springer Publishing). Two new Books are under development and will be published in 2010.

As Chief, New Hospital Design and Construction, Children's Memorial Hospital, Chicago, Bruce is leading the team to create the tallest Children's Hospital in the World, a new 1.25 million square foot, 23 story facility in downtown Chicago. Prior to this position, Bruce led the pre construction planning for the University of California San Francisco, (UCSF), Mission Bay Project, a $1.5 Billion, Children's, Women's and Cancer Hospital.
